Challenges in Making the Perfect Crepes - Crepe Pro

WebThe lack of fat will make browning more difficult and could lead to excessive cooking time to get the right color - dehydrating the crepes even more. Adding more oil or fat to the pan in an attempt to fix this problem can make it worse, since the oil allows for a higher cooking temp that will drive away more moisture from steam.
